Enterprise Resource Planning vs. Accounting: Understanding the Key Differences
While both ERP and accounting systems play a role to organizational success, they function in distinct ways. Accounting software emphasizes monetary transactions, monitoring income, expenses, and resources. ERP, on the other hand, is a more wide-ranging system that unifies various departmental processes, including accounting. It also encompasses areas like supply chain management, human resources, and customer relationship management.
- Therefore, ERP provides a broader view of the business, while accounting software delivers a specific look at financial performance.
To put it simply, choosing between ERP and accounting depends on your specific needs. If you require a system to control all aspects of your business, then ERP is the preferred option. However, if your primary focus is on financial recording, then accounting software may be sufficient.
